Mendix 通过增加 Kubernetes 支持为企业提供无与伦比的云原生部署选项 | Mendix

跳到主要内容
新闻稿

Mendix 通过增加 Kubernetes 支持,为企业提供无与伦比的云原生部署选项

Mendix 成为首个支持容器编排事实标准的低代码平台,为企业提供更多选择和控制

波士顿 – 14 年 2017 月 XNUMX 日Mendix,创建和持续改进移动和 Web 应用程序的最快、最简单的平台,今天宣布支持 Kubernetes 开源容器编排系统。 Mendix 是第一个支持 Kubernetes 的低代码平台,并且已经拥有在 Kubernetes 上运行生产应用程序的企业客户,实现了大规模的自动部署和持续交付。

尽管 Docker 已成为开发人员构建和运行容器的流行工具,但企业 IT 组织仍面临大规模管理容器的挑战。由于大多数应用程序都将软件打包到多个容器中并使用其他服务(例如数据存储、缓存和负载平衡器),因此手动管理多个独立的生命周期会带来很大的复杂性。Kubernetes 等容器编排系统通过跨主机集群自动部署、扩展和操作应用程序容器(包括 Docker),解决了这一挑战。

在此版本中, Mendix 增加了对 Kubernetes 的支持,使客户能够运行 Mendix 分布式环境中的应用程序,并使用业界事实上的容器编排标准支持微服务架构。客户现在可以部署 Mendix 通过 Docker 容器跨 Kubernetes 编排的服务器集群部署应用程序。对于 DevOps 工作流,可以使用流行的自动化服务器(如 Jenkins)在集群上构建和部署容器。这意味着客户现在可以在几乎任何 PaaS 堆栈上享受与 Cloud Foundry 相关的相同部署便利性和水平可扩展性。这包括商业 PaaS 解决方案和容器即服务 (CaaS) 产品,以及企业可以使用 Docker 和 Kubernetes 自行组装的框架。 Mendix 对 Kubernetes 的支持包括一组操作方法以及在 Azure 容器服务上运行的 Jenkins/Kubernetes 参考实现。

“自从采用 MendixEnexis 已将 50 多个应用程序投入生产。今年,我们正在实施多云战略,以保持这种大规模速度,”Enexis 集团企业架构师 Gert-Jan van Gisteren 表示。“我们的战略的一部分是将无状态应用程序容器化,以确保弹性可扩展性、完全控制和降低基础设施成本。Kubernetes 无缝融入我们的 CI/CD 管道(Gitlab、Artifactory、Ansible Tower),使我们能够部署、监控和管理我们的关键任务 Mendix 应用程序可以快速、可靠且低成本地运行。”

Mendix 继续为企业级低代码云平台制定标准

Mendix 从一开始就构建为云原生应用平台。该公司的云原生架构一直受到领先分析师的认可,一直走在利用开放和互补云技术的前沿,为企业提供无与伦比的多云部署、可移植性、可扩展性和高可用性:

  • 2014:
    • Mendix 公布 Cloud Foundry 支持 并且仍然是唯一一家在运行时利用 Cloud Foundry 作为核心技术的低代码平台供应商,因此企业可以灵活地在任何基于 Cloud Foundry 的环境中运行其应用程序,包括 AWS、IBM Bluemix、 Mendix 云、Microsoft Azure、Pivo​​tal 和 SAP 云平台。
  • 2015年:
    • Mendix 继续执行其 Cloud Foundry 战略,宣布 与 Pivotal 合作 一键部署 Mendix 应用直接在 Pivotal Cloud Foundry (PCF)、AWS 上的 PCF 或 Pivotal Web Services 中 Mendix.
    • Mendix 开放其源代码 Mendix Cloud Foundry 构建包,以便任何(私有)Cloud Foundry安装都可以运行 Mendix 以及。
  • 2016年:
    • Mendix 介绍其 下一代云原生架构,使运行时完全无状态,以便客户可以利用大规模可扩展性和 HA 故障转移。此外, Mendix 发布一个 新版本公开 Mendix 云 它在 AWS 的多个区域和可用区域上运行,具有开箱即用的 HA 故障转移功能。
    • Mendix 进一步拓宽了客户的部署选项,成为第一家推出 Docker支持. 客户可以使用 Docker 容器在几乎任何私有云、虚拟私有云或本地基础设施上部署他们的应用程序。
  • 2017年:
    • Mendix 支持 开放服务代理 API,这使得 Cloud Foundry 中的服务代理功能可以独立使用。该 API 允许应用程序查找并绑定到平台级服务,例如消息队列或数据库。
    • Mendix 标志着低代码行业又一个第一,增加了 Kubernetes 支持 为企业客户提供更多部署选择和控制。客户可以利用 Kubernetes 来管理 Mendix 跨 Kubernetes 集群的运行时实例。

“开源项目和商业产品之间协作和互操作性增强的趋势,以及综合 PaaS 框架关键功能的拆分,正在创造更多的部署选择,”首席技术官 Johan den Haan 表示。 Mendix. “唯一一个拥有先进的云原生架构和对开放云生态系统深度支持的低代码平台, Mendix 支持最广泛的部署场景。从完全托管的公共 Mendix 云,到 Cloud Foundry 或基于 Docker/Kubernetes 的 PaaS,再到使用 Docker、Kubernetes 和 Jenkins 等工具定制的 CI/CD 和容器堆栈, Mendix 以独特的方式为企业提供了一系列选择,使其能够根据业务和运营需求平衡简单性和控制力。”

可用性

Mendix 对 Kubernetes 的支持已普遍可用。

了解更多:

    关于我们 Mendix

    Mendix,以 Siemens business,是唯一一款旨在解决企业软件开发挑战的所有复杂性的低代码平台。部署单点解决方案来解决部门问题可以解决微观层面的问题——但如果您想对业务产生重大影响,您需要更进一步,构建强大的产品组合,以可持续和战略性地推动发展。

    与 Mendix通过让每个人都参与捕捉需求、形成想法以及在软件组合的整个生命周期中嵌入价值评估,企业可以采取更复杂的变革举措。

    专注于正确的问题,同时依靠治理和控制来避免不必要的风险。动员您的组织。建立变革准备能力。当下一个伟大的想法出现时,更快地将其转化为成果。

    4,000 个国家/地区的 46 多个组织使用 Mendix 低代码平台。超过 300,000 名开发人员组成的活跃社区已经创建了超过 950,000 个应用程序,并且这一数字还在不断增加。

    选择你的语言